Ferroelectric Material Reveals Unexpected, Intriguing Behavior
Abstract:
In electronics-based technologies, metal-oxide compounds known as “relaxor ferroelectrics” often make up key circuit components due to their unique electrical behavior. They are good insulators and can sustain large electric fields, making them excellent at storing electric charge. They can also turn a mechanical force, like squeezing, into electrical energy.
